The Data Operations team is the backbone of data integrity at RBC Global Asset Management. The team creates and maintains securities, issuers, accounts, and benchmarks that power the systems supporting investment operations across the organisation.
This work enables Investment teams, Trade Operations, Fund Operations, Performance, and other stakeholders to execute trades, onboard clients, report performance, and advance GAM-wide strategic initiatives with confidence.
